Week 10 - April 22, 2024
NE10 Player of the Week
Katelyn Hadden, Southern New Hampshire
Graduate Student | Attack | Newburyport, Mass.
Hadden registered 15 points on eight goals and seven assists during a 2-0 week for SNHU. She also added eight ground balls, two draw controls and caused five turnovers. Hadden tallied four goals, two assists, two draw controls and three caused turnovers in Tuesday's 21-7 win against Franklin Pierce. She then notched four goals, a career-high five assists, seven ground balls and two caused turnovers in a 26-11 victory over American International on Saturday.
NE10 Defensive Player of the Week
Angelina Porcello, Pace
Senior | Midfield | Eastchester, N.Y.
Porcello got the job done on both sides of the field in a 2-0 week for Pace. Against Southern Connecticut, Porcello scored one goal while handing out for assists. She also added eight ground balls, five draw controls and seven caused turnovers. Against Saint Rose, Porcello contributed two goals and one assist on offense. On defense, she secured seven ground balls, two draws and six caused turnovers. Her totals this week were 10 points (three goals, seven assists), 15 ground balls, seven draw controls and 13 caused turnovers.
NE10 Goalkeeper of the Week
Gabby Buscemi, New Haven
Senior | Goalkeeper | East Patchogue, N.Y.
The Chargers primary goalkeeper, Buscemi played all but two of the 120 minutes this past weekend, leading the Chargers to a 2-0 week with road wins at Saint Rose and at Bentley. Against the Golden Knights, she finished with six saves while surrendering just five goals in a 16-5 win. In the weekend finale at Bentley, she tied her career-high with 18 saves, including one in the final 90 seconds of the game to secure the 14-13 victory. She totaled 24 saves and a 57.1 save percentage for New Haven this week.
NE10 Rookie of the Week
Maddie Schubert, Pace
Sophomore | Midfielder | Port Jefferson Station, N.Y.
Schubert provided seven goals and two assists in two dominant wins for No. 1 Pace. Against Southern Connecticut, Schubert fired off six goals while also causing one turnover. In the Setters' rout of Saint Rose, Schubert chipped in one goal and an assist.
NE10 Weekly Honor Roll
Danielle Marino, Adelphi (Gr., A/M - West Islip, N.Y.)
Adelphi went 2-0 last week, aided by an 11-point performance from Marino. She scored at least a hat trick in both victories, while adding four assists overall. She went perfect in free position attempts and also collected eight ground balls. In a 19-6 win over Franklin Pierce she scored four times with three helpers for a team-leading seven points.
Jenna Joseph, Assumption (Gr., A - Longmeadow, Mass.)
Joseph continued to accumulate points, recording six points in each game this past week. She began the week with three goals and three assists against No. 3 Adelphi and capped off the week with one goal and five assists in the Greyhounds' 12-7 win over Southern Connecticut. During the year, she led the NE10 by 14 assists (43) and ranked fourth in points.
Maeve Johnson, Bentley (Sr., A - Duxbury, Mass.)
Johnson scored seven goals on Saturday in a 14-13 loss to New Haven. That was her third game in the last four with at least six goals.
Ivanna Hernandez, New Haven (Sr., M - Bay Shore, N.Y.)
Hernandez led the Chargers offense to a pair of victories last week, including a 14-13 road win over Bentley to maintain control over third place in the league standings. Overall for the week, she racked up seven points on five goals and two assists with one of her goals coming on a free position shot. She opened up the week with five points in an 11 goal victory over Saint Rose, adding a draw control and caused turnover in that game. Against Bentley, she finished with two goals, with her two goals coming on her only two shots.
Maggie Fitzgerald, Saint Anselm (Sr., M - Holliston, Mass.)
Fitzgerald led the No. 22 Saint Anselm with a career-high five goals and one assist to match her career-best of six points to take down Daemen, 18-5, on Saturday. She fired nine total shot attempts with six on frame for a 66.7 on-goal shooting percentage.
Sophia Lynch, St. Michael's (So., A - West Hartford, Conn.)
Lynch posted three goals, one assist, six ground balls and three caused turnovers during a 19-7 win at Felician on Saturday.
Alexis DeLucia, Southern N.H. (Sr., MF - Uncasville, Conn.)
DeLucia caused five turnovers, collected six ground balls and won 14 draw controls, while contributing two goals and two assists on offense, during a 2-0 week for SNHU. DeLucia tallied three caused turnovers, three ground balls, nine draw controls and a goal in a 21-7 victory over Franklin Pierce on Tuesday. She recorded two caused turnovers, three ground balls, five draw controls, a goal and two helpers in Saturday's 26-11 triumph against American Int'l.
Nicole Mirra, Southern N.H. (Fr., GK - Cicero, N.Y.)
Mirra stopped 12 of the 23 shots she faced during a 2-0 week for SNHU. She earned the win in a 21-7 victory over Franklin Pierce on Tuesday, as she made nine saves on 16 shots. Mirra entered in relief to begin the second half of Saturday's 26-11 win against American International and turned away three of seven shots.
